Registration is underway for the Paducah City League - Tee Ball, Baseball, and Softball. Paducah Parks Services invites parents of youth 5 to 12 years old who are interested in playing baseball, softball, or tee ball to register now for the upcoming league at the Noble Park fields.
You can register at the Parks office at 1400 HC Mathis Drive from 8 am to 5 pm. Monday through Friday or attend a special registration day for the Paducah City League on Saturday, February 25 from 9 am to noon at the Parks office.
Parents should bring a birth certificate for all kids they plan to register. The registration fee is $40 for baseball and softball and $35 for tee ball. Since coaches are volunteers, all parents are asked to consider helping to coach.
Players must turn 5 or 6 years old on or before August 31, 2017 to play in the tee ball division. Players who turn 7 years or older on or before August 31, 2017 will play baseball or softball.
The registration deadline for baseball and softball is Tuesday, March 14. The deadline for tee ball is Tuesday March 21. Practices will start in mid-April. Games will be on Saturdays starting May 13 and will include some Tuesday night games in June.
